Skip to content

[Backport] FRW-11006 Adjusted the login flow#1

Closed
olhalivitchuk wants to merge 1 commit intotag-1.5.1from
backport/1.6.0
Closed

[Backport] FRW-11006 Adjusted the login flow#1
olhalivitchuk wants to merge 1 commit intotag-1.5.1from
backport/1.6.0

Conversation

@olhalivitchuk
Copy link
Collaborator

Release Table

Module Release Type Constraint Updates
MultiFactorAuth minor SecurityGuiExtension, SprykerShop.AgentPageExtension, SprykerShop.CustomerPageExtension

Module MultiFactorAuth

Change log

Improvements

  • Introduced MultiFactorAuthFacade::invalidateUserCodes() and MultiFactorAuthFacade::invalidateCustomerCodes() to invalidate active authentication codes before login as part of adjusted MFA flow.
  • Introduced AgentUserMultiFactorAuthenticationHandlerPlugin.invalidateAgentCodes(), CustomerMultiFactorAuthenticationHandlerPlugin::invalidateCustomerCodes(), UserMultiFactorAuthenticationHandlerPlugin::invalidateUserCodes() to invalidate active codes.
  • Added MultiFactorAuthValidationRequest.isLogin field to distinguish login flow from other validation scenarios.

Adjustments

  • Increased spryker-shop/agent-page-extension constraint to ^1.2.0.
  • Increased spryker-shop/customer-page-extension constraint to ^1.8.0.
  • Increased spryker/security-gui-extension constraint to ^1.4.0.

@olhalivitchuk olhalivitchuk changed the title FRW-11006 Adjusted the login flow [Backport] FRW-11006 Adjusted the login flow Nov 26, 2025
@spryker-release-bot spryker-release-bot deleted the backport/1.6.0 branch December 10, 2025 11:15
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Development

Successfully merging this pull request may close these issues.

3 participants